Official title: An open randomized study to evaluate the immunogenicity and reactogenicity of SmithKline Beecham Biologicals' combined hepatitis A/hepatitis B vaccine compared to separate vaccinations with commercially available hepatitis A and hepatitis B vaccines of SmithKline Beecham Biologicals, when injected in healthy adult volunteers
Trial description: An open randomized study to evaluate the immunogenicity and reactogenicity of SmithKline Beecham Biologicals' combined hepatitis A/hepatitis B vaccine compared to separate vaccinations with commercially available hepatitis A and hepatitis B vaccines of SmithKline Beecham Biologicals, when injected in healthy adult volunteers
